It is not illegal to hunt just like it is not illegal for LSU to cage a tiger and parade it around Tiger Stadium. However, there are rules and regulations that come into play for both.
If you hunt without a license, or hunt game out of season, or exceed the daily bag limits, or violate all the other game laws that are too numerous to mention, it is likely that your hunting days will be numbered.
For LSU, there are guidelines it must follow in order to become an accredited tiger sanctuary. If LSU doesn't become accredited it will have an increasingly difficult task finding future Mike the tigers without purchasing them from black market breeders.
